About Farheen Prabhakar’s career Born as Farheen Khan, she made her Bollywood debut opposite Ronit Roy in 1992 with Deepak Balraj Vij’s Jaan Tere Naam. Their pairing created magic and made them overnight sensations. With her uncanny resemblance to Madhuri Dixit, she instantly caught the attention of filmmakers and audiences alike, and many dubbed her Madhuri’s lookalike.
